Product Definition:
Industrial automation systems are those systems that are used to automate the industrial process. These systems can include anything from robotics and PLCs to sensors and HMIs. The purpose of industrial automation is to improve the efficiency, accuracy, and consistency of the manufacturing process.
Fixed or Hard Automation:
Fixed or hard automation is a type of industrial automation system that performs several tasks repetitively with the help of programmed instructions. Fixed or hard automation systems are used in industries such as food & beverage, pharmaceuticals, and chemicals for performing critical functions such as raw material processing and product manufacturing.
Programmable Automation:
Programmable automation and it's usage in industrial automation systems market is used to control the operation of machinery or devices based on a series of instructions. It is also known as PLC (programmable logic controller) or PC (programmable control). Programmable automation system can be programmed to carry out a set of instructions over and over again by using software. These systems are used for controlling various processes in industries such as chemical, paper & pulp, food & beverages, oil refinery among others.
